TXT files use the MIME type text/plain and contain unformatted text data suitable for general use. PICON files typically have a unique MIME type depending on the application but are designed to store structured, iconographic, or formatted content. Conversion codecs handle the parsing and restructuring of plain text into the PICON format to preserve content integrity and readability.

Keep individual TXT files under 5–10 MB for fastest browser-based conversion; larger files may be slower or require a desktop tool.
Preserve encoding by ensuring TXT is saved as UTF-8 when it contains non-Latin characters to avoid character corruption in PICON.
For many small files, use batch conversion to produce one PICON per file; for archival, aggregate into a single PICON if the tool supports it.
Note that PICON is designed for compact or portable document/icon representation — heavy binary embeds or complex formatting from other document types will not translate.
